After bringing Moran Avni to the depths of the mirror world outside Trier in reality, Angel finally let go of the "man in the mirror" who was being strangled by the neck and pinched by the collar and was completely unable to resist.

The latter had just revealed his strength of the middle sequence of the Arbitrator Path in the brief battle with the "Law Mage" Yalishia Tamara. Angel guessed that it was probably a "Punishment Knight", otherwise his "imprisonment" would never be effective on a target with divinity.

The mirror double is naturally a special ability unique to the "person in the mirror" and has nothing to do with one's own path.

Throwing Moran, who was nearly sixty years old, with graying black hair and prominent wrinkles on both sides of his nose, to a dark place far away from the exit of the mirror world, Angel looked down at him, showing a kind smile, and asked in the most charming voice possible:
“Are you the newest Minister of Industry, Moran Avni?”

Moran, whose physique and strength had been enhanced many times by the potion but who was unable to move in Angel's hands, rolled over to steady himself. When he heard Angel's deliberately gentle voice, an unnatural flush appeared on his face, which was originally panicked and angry. His heartbeat suddenly accelerated, his blood vessels dilated, and his thinking became less sharp.

"I, I am."

He answered hurriedly, fearing that the beauty in front of him would be dissatisfied with him.

The other party's brutal behavior just now was naturally due to his eagerness to rescue himself from the attacker, which is completely forgivable.

If the woman in front of him had told him in advance, he could even take the initiative to follow her and leave without her having to use force.

Humph... Looking at Moran Avni, who was completely trapped in the dual control of charm and "conquest" and whose eyes became confused, Angel snorted and shook his head. She was about to ask a few questions in this state when she felt that the mirror channels extending like a spider web around her were disturbed. One of them quickly became brighter, and a purple flame spread along this channel from a farther distance and reached her almost instantly.

In the silent explosion, the purple flame turned into a human form and slowly stood up.

This was an old man wearing a blue military dress with a ribbon and medals on his chest. His short dark red hair was neatly combed back, his face had obvious wrinkles, and his nearly black eyes were extremely sharp.

As soon as he landed, his eyes were fixed on Angel, making the latter's spiritual alertness even higher.

There is no doubt that this is an angel, a "weather wizard".

Angel quickly went through several Hunter Angels that he either knew or had only heard of, and quickly determined the identity of the person in front of him:
One of the few angels in Intis who does not belong to an official organization, the president of the "Iron Cross", "Weather Warlock" Dist.

This month, the military's "weather wizard" was on duty, so how come he was the one tracking Moran? And a hunter could walk in the mirror world as easily as on flat ground, so was he also replaced by the "man in the mirror"?

Several questions quickly popped up in Angel's mind, and he soon discovered that although the other party had handsomely used the incarnation of fire to land here, and seemed to be very powerful on the surface, he was actually paying careful attention to the surrounding environment and seemed not so at ease.

He should have just used a certain seal to enter the mirror world... After clearing out the "Mirror Man" spies last time and discovering that they had infiltrated various organizations, Trier's extraordinary people should have prepared corresponding means... Thinking of this, Angel's mouth curled up slightly, and the last bit of respect for this suddenly appeared angel disappeared without a trace.

In the mirror world, witches have a huge advantage over hunters of the same sequence.

But before she could say a few harsh words, Dist, with an aloof expression, turned his head to look at Moran Avni, who was kneeling on the ground and had not yet woken up from the "charm", snorted coldly, and turned his gaze to Angel.

Then, He nodded as a greeting, turned around and transformed into a purple flame, and left in a flash along the passage in the mirror that He had just come from.

This... Why did He fall down before I even made a move? No, why did He run away?
Angel, who was ready for battle, never expected that the other side had no intention of taking action at all, and decisively abandoned the captured Minister of Industry Moran.

Unless, He had no intention of protecting Moran, and coming to take a look was just a routine matter, or...

Angel instantly thought of the other angel who secretly supported the "Red Angel" Medici when he last met him, that the "Iron Blood Cross" still believed in the "True Creator", and that he had recently entrusted Lovia from Silver City to contact the Lord she believed in to start follow-up cooperation.

Was he the one hiding in the dark? Did he return to Medici's service because he still believed in the "True Creator"? Or did he intend to compete with him for the position of Chief Hunter under the throne of the god?

Watching the fire of this angel with multiple identities fading away, Angel chuckled and looked down at Moran Avni. The latter had just come to his senses, but was again intoxicated by Angel's smile and showed a flattering expression.

"How many years have you been lurking within the government as Moran Avni's 'Mirror Man'?"

Angel's question automatically changed its meaning in Moran's ears. The tone of admiration, as if exploring how great his career was, made Moran involuntarily straighten his chest and proudly answer:

"It has been 1315 years since 36."

You are quite proud... But this means that Moran Avni was replaced almost as soon as he came of age. He had no political potential at the time... Was it simply the hatred of the "Mirror Man" towards his original body that led to his becoming a powerful figure, and only after he gradually developed this identity and held a high position did he welcome the cooperation of other "Mirror Man" and the "School of Truth"? Another piece of intelligence shows that Moran's several illegitimate children can trigger the reaction of the "special mirror fragments". If he replaced his original body early, the offspring he gave birth to may indeed be related to the Mirror Man...

Angel's thoughts raced, and he confirmed that Moran was not lying at this time, so he immediately asked the next question:
"How many members of the Avni family are like you?" "A lot, more than a third."

Moran raised his head and answered, satisfied to see a hint of surprise on the face of the woman in front of him. This made him name the family members who had been replaced by the "man in the mirror" without much hesitation. There were senior military officials, important police officers, and backbones from all walks of life, and so on.

They are spread across the military, politics, business, academia and the art world... After hearing a long list of "Avini" names and their corresponding jobs and positions, even though Angel had expected it, he couldn't help but reveal a surprised expression.

With the mutual protection and help of these "mirror people", more of their kind have the opportunity to kidnap the original bodies and kill them in the mirror world, thereby completely replacing each other's identities, taking root in all walks of life in Trier, and even spreading to other cities and countries.

The "Iron Knight" Syrio Soren whom Angel met, and the betrayed Nighthawk informant Danio Brown were probably first contaminated by the power of underground Trier, producing the corresponding mirror man, and then being replaced by him.

From this point of view, the Avni family should be the earliest "lurkers" in this period. It is not ruled out that they were originally helped to gain a foothold by the earlier "Mirror Man". This is left to the Tamara family to investigate. It has nothing to do with me... Angel wrote down the information and smiled approvingly, letting Moran continue to be controlled by the "charm" and unable to extricate himself, and then asked:
"I have something I want to talk to the 'leader' of your people in the mirror about. Can you contact him?"

She had already learned from the "Man in the Mirror" Syrio about the existence of such a leader, and had vaguely guessed his identity, so she directly asked for his contact information. She also called this mysterious man "Him", pretending to be familiar with him.

But even so, Moran Avni still showed a struggling expression, as if the answer to this question was more important than the favor of the beautiful woman in front of him. However, under Angel's earnest expression of "please", Moran's tightly pursed lips finally loosened and said:

“I can contact Him through a classical silver mirror that I have placed at home and a special ritual to communicate with the world in the mirror… Since I will soon be moving into a villa arranged by the government, this mirror will soon be handed over to my deputy Griffith, who will keep it for safekeeping to prevent it from being discovered by official Beyonders.

"The steps of the ritual are..."

Seeing Moran speaking more and more fluently with a mentality as if he had overcome his inner demons and was sure that beauty was more important than secrets, Angel nodded with satisfaction and wrote down the ritual method.

She decided to return to the other party's residence later to retrieve the silver mirror to avoid the inevitable search for the mirror after Moran's disappearance.

Of course, Angel did not forget to inquire about the deputy's identity so that he could write a letter of complaint to Trier's official Beyonder for processing when he had time.

After receiving this information, Angel's mission was accomplished. However, looking at Moran's increasingly "charming" expression, which made him look like a "dog licker", she decided to ask a few more questions to make the best use of him.

"During this period, has anyone from the 'School of Truth' come to you?"

She continued to force a smile on her face, causing Moran to nod hurriedly:
"Yes, yes, and you will never guess his identity."

"Nast Solomon, 'Lord of the Five Seas'?"

Angel said quickly, causing Moran to look surprised.

"Yes... It's him. He said he was working with us on behalf of the 'School of Truth' and got the contact information of the 'leader'... But he seemed to have disappeared in the past two months. There is no news..."

he murmured.

Disappeared... because the mausoleum of Roselle was found, and the "Man in the Mirror" and their leader lost their function? Angel thought about it and asked casually:
"What 'collaboration' are they going to have?"

"I don't know," Moran answered honestly, "I am only responsible for contacting the leader, or completing some things through transactions under his orders. These are all very complicated purposes, making it difficult for people to get a glimpse of the whole picture... But Nestor once mentioned that a huge 'vortex' is about to take shape, and everyone, including us, will be sucked into it, paying the corresponding price and getting the desired results."

Whirlpool... Angel muttered the word silently. Just as he was about to ask in depth, he noticed that Moran's expression in front of him changed drastically.

Panic, pain, and fear appeared on his face at the same time, and his dark gray eyes shone brightly from within, as if a strong light was lit inside his head.

Not good... Angel subconsciously wanted to throw Moran back to the real world to stop the changes in his body, but before she could make any move, Moran's head exploded into a ball of fireworks in a burst of light, and his headless body collapsed to the ground with a dull sound.

Following the spiritual prompt, Angel looked back into the depths of the mirror world.

A female figure in a black dress with a blurry outline flashed by and quickly disappeared into the winding and twisting mirror passage.
